Notice to Offerors: Clarification / Question Deadline


All questions and requests for clarification regarding this solicitation must be submitted in writing no later than September 3, 2026, at 10:00 AM EDT.


The Government will make every effort to respond to all timely received questions by close of business (COB) September 4, 2026. Questions received after the deadline may not be answered.


Submit all inquiries via email to jessica.briggs@us.af.mil and natasha.randall@us.af.mil


DO NOT encrypt or password-protect email transmissions or question attachments. Encrypted submissions cannot be accessed or opened by the Government, and any questions submitted in an unreadable format will not receive a response.

8/21/2026: The Air Force Research Laboratory (AFRL) is announcing a synopsis and solicitation for the 711th Mission Support Services Multiple Award Contract (MAC) Indefinite Delivery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) vehicle. This notice of contract action constitutes a formal synopsis and solicitation and requires the submission of proposals. This procurement is advertised as an 8(a) set aside. This procurement will use RFO Part 15 Request for Proposal (RFP) process and intends to award a MAC IDIQ contract to the responsible offerors whose proposal conforms to the RFP. Future requirements and deliverables will be determined by the Contracting Officer, who will issue written Orders to the contractor in accordance with FAR Part 16.5.


The North American Industry Classification System Code (NAICS) is 541990 and the size standard is $19.5M. Foreign participation is not authorized.


The basic IDIQ period will have a five (5) year ordering period with a six (6) year period of performance. The estimated maximum dollar value is $505,000,000.00. Order values will be determined by the future needs of AFRL/711th HPW. The government makes no representation as to the number of orders. Task Order 1, Kick Off Meeting, will serve as the minimum guarantee at the issuance of the contract. There is not a guarantee of work in excess of the minimum guarantee. The Government intends to evaluate proposals and award without negotiations; however, the Government retains the right to hold negotiations if determined appropriate.

Electrical Equipment Operation and Maintenance Services Contract Electrical Maintenance Contract (EMC)
Solicitation # FA239626RB004
The Department of the Air Force, through the Air Force Research Laboratory, has issued solicitation FA239626RB004 for On-site High Voltage Electrical Equipment Support Services at Wright-Patterson Air Force Base, Ohio. This small business set-aside contract requires a contractor to provide all personnel, tools, and materials for non-personal engineering, maintenance, and repair services for over 3,000 critical low- and medium-voltage electrical assets across 49 research facilities. The scope includes managing over 100,000 HP of rotating equipment and performing both scheduled preventive maintenance and emergency troubleshooting. The contract is structured as a Firm Fixed Price arrangement with a base period of 12 months starting September 10, 2026, and includes multiple option periods extending through March 2032. Selection will be conducted using a best value tradeoff methodology where technical capability is significantly more important than price. A mandatory pass/fail gate requires the contractor to hold current InterNational Electrical Testing Association (NETA) accreditation and provide NETA-certified personnel. Technical evaluation factors include the quality of personnel, staffing and management plans, local market presence within 50 miles of the base, and a robust quality control plan. Additionally, the contractor must demonstrate strong past performance in similar NETA testing services. Security requirements are stringent, necessitating Secret-level clearances for key personnel, compliance with Operations Security (OPSEC) programs, and adherence to protocols for handling Controlled Unclassified Information (CUI) and classified technical data.
